US government to vet users of OpenAI's latest AI model

OpenAI has announced that the U.S. government will be involved in vetting users for its newest AI model. This decision raises concerns about potential government control over access to advanced AI technologies. The move follows discussions about the power and potential risks associated with highly capable AI systems. AI
